@@ -3,29 +3,33 @@ class Dooit < Formula
33
44 desc "TUI todo manager"
55 homepage "https://github.com/kraanzu/dooit"
6- url "https://files.pythonhosted.org/packages/ab/0f/3d3649b0d8e2634e5a5231d08386d0c339510b3f17afe9277c588863006c /dooit-3.1 .0.tar.gz"
7- sha256 "ceb0faa4d5a93976a3895505b66c11a80a16c616d6a7d20bbfa9e6c2dbe7c05a "
6+ url "https://files.pythonhosted.org/packages/00/41/5b1dc3820a54506a12c33c84467f6a12e51b845500a5df39c42cdb3fe4e0 /dooit-3.2 .0.tar.gz"
7+ sha256 "c7e41bfc57e6f0fae941015936e78025baf77f0bde542f3e5e4c7030ce72656c "
88 license "MIT"
99 head "https://github.com/kraanzu/dooit.git" , branch : "main"
1010
1111 bottle do
12- rebuild 1
13- sha256 cellar : :any , arm64_sequoia : "28e26bfd0d1b64a2c5e6c8f2530f8226e5293a15831f923879d588a68b8e8e25"
14- sha256 cellar : :any , arm64_sonoma : "3063a42abfe79996679469529c459da907354d9450a141695a7e412bb8308e33"
15- sha256 cellar : :any , arm64_ventura : "0e8872e9a7b67579b3693d9a5874084801991ab019c17b1b2683315c7052bd2e"
16- sha256 cellar : :any , sonoma : "3417fc5d17fa21ad45adaacd71eaf9c370352d41a81f9cc2bc77023524629421"
17- sha256 cellar : :any , ventura : "5aab34101df08674d9b15a59fe0896f8f43d0c895ffb1a41980c62368ec57e9d"
18- sha256 cellar : :any_skip_relocation , arm64_linux : "13ec57f38d60cea7e37c327ded456256856a3ab4987d6a4cba68f4af78dd4bae"
19- sha256 cellar : :any_skip_relocation , x86_64_linux : "d74e67a6601a1be24dae34f987a97d076c551d9f64827451f23beef5d42401e2"
12+ sha256 cellar : :any , arm64_sequoia : "4263ea12518e0b63cb9941091f8a9e12460f8c51237f1e498fa207fa30b0a7c0"
13+ sha256 cellar : :any , arm64_sonoma : "1afd68a5be6b259250b0f6ba3fc786e70b7108d946fef304c837a6ceadcabed4"
14+ sha256 cellar : :any , arm64_ventura : "0eea25ed44fdc4775fb42654eb9de6eb5a3b28339b890f3d0502d409a9a42cfc"
15+ sha256 cellar : :any , sonoma : "e3f606d49c5edd61f956707d1a6d78be832a772557bec0c6ddcabc9948769930"
16+ sha256 cellar : :any , ventura : "9ce81743403b17fb1173b8c3e1fcada2a573c998ad5ddc95f7abf748e23e892f"
17+ sha256 cellar : :any_skip_relocation , arm64_linux : "c5052e0af75cf840b45c49635839174743d271a864f5517685dc2072debc622b"
18+ sha256 cellar : :any_skip_relocation , x86_64_linux : "a3b47e89bce96f9405b0e19492e8d6dbf883e744ab212c7a168b7231eb74abf1"
2019 end
2120
2221 depends_on "cmake" => :build
2322 depends_on "libyaml"
2423 depends_on "python@3.13"
2524
2625 resource "click" do
27- url "https://files.pythonhosted.org/packages/96/d3/f04c7bfcf5c1862a2a5b845c6b2b360488cf47af55dfa79c98f6a6bf98b5/click-8.1.7.tar.gz"
28- sha256 "ca9853ad459e787e2192211578cc907e7594e294c7ccc834310722b41b9ca6de"
26+ url "https://files.pythonhosted.org/packages/cd/0f/62ca20172d4f87d93cf89665fbaedcd560ac48b465bd1d92bfc7ea6b0a41/click-8.2.0.tar.gz"
27+ sha256 "f5452aeddd9988eefa20f90f05ab66f17fce1ee2a36907fd30b05bbb5953814d"
28+ end
29+
30+ resource "greenlet" do
31+ url "https://files.pythonhosted.org/packages/34/c1/a82edae11d46c0d83481aacaa1e578fea21d94a1ef400afd734d47ad95ad/greenlet-3.2.2.tar.gz"
32+ sha256 "ad053d34421a2debba45aa3cc39acf454acbcd025b3fc1a9f8a0dee237abd485"
2933 end
3034
3135 resource "linkify-it-py" do
@@ -49,13 +53,13 @@ class Dooit < Formula
4953 end
5054
5155 resource "platformdirs" do
52- url "https://files.pythonhosted.org/packages/13/fc/128cc9cb8f03208bdbf93d3aa862e16d376844a14f9a0ce5cf4507372de4 /platformdirs-4.3.6 .tar.gz"
53- sha256 "357fb2acbc885b0419afd3ce3ed34564c13c9b95c89360cd9563f73aa5e2b907 "
56+ url "https://files.pythonhosted.org/packages/fe/8b/3c73abc9c759ecd3f1f7ceff6685840859e8070c4d947c93fae71f6a0bf2 /platformdirs-4.3.8 .tar.gz"
57+ sha256 "3d512d96e16bcb959a814c9f348431070822a6496326a4be0911c40b5a74c2bc "
5458 end
5559
5660 resource "pygments" do
57- url "https://files.pythonhosted.org/packages/8e/62/8336eff65bcbc8e4cb5d05b55faf041285951b6e80f33e2bff2024788f31 /pygments-2.18.0 .tar.gz"
58- sha256 "786ff802f32e91311bff3889f6e9a86e81505fe99f2735bb6d60ae0c5004f199 "
61+ url "https://files.pythonhosted.org/packages/7c/2d/c3338d48ea6cc0feb8446d8e6937e1408088a72a39937982cc6111d17f84 /pygments-2.19.1 .tar.gz"
62+ sha256 "61c16d2a8576dc0649d9f39e089b5f02bcd27fba10d8fb4dcc28173f7a45151f "
5963 end
6064
6165 resource "pyperclip" do
@@ -74,33 +78,33 @@ class Dooit < Formula
7478 end
7579
7680 resource "rich" do
77- url "https://files.pythonhosted.org/packages/ab/3a/0316b28d0761c6734d6bc14e770d85506c986c85ffb239e688eeaab2c2bc /rich-13.9.4 .tar.gz"
78- sha256 "439594978a49a09530cff7ebc4b5c7103ef57baf48d5ea3184f21d9a2befa098 "
81+ url "https://files.pythonhosted.org/packages/a1/53/830aa4c3066a8ab0ae9a9955976fb770fe9c6102117c8ec4ab3ea62d89e8 /rich-14.0.0 .tar.gz"
82+ sha256 "82f1bc23a6a21ebca4ae0c45af9bdbc492ed20231dcb63f297d6d1021a9d5725 "
7983 end
8084
8185 resource "six" do
82- url "https://files.pythonhosted.org/packages/71/39/171f1c67cd00715f190ba0b100d606d440a28c93c7714febeca8b79af85e /six-1.16 .0.tar.gz"
83- sha256 "1e61c37477a1626458e36f7b1d82aa5c9b094fa4802892072e49de9c60c4c926 "
86+ url "https://files.pythonhosted.org/packages/94/e7/b2c673351809dca68a0e064b6af791aa332cf192da575fd474ed7d6f16a2 /six-1.17 .0.tar.gz"
87+ sha256 "ff70335d468e7eb6ec65b95b99d3a2836546063f63acc5171de367e834932a81 "
8488 end
8589
8690 resource "sqlalchemy" do
87- url "https://files.pythonhosted.org/packages/50/65/9cbc9c4c3287bed2499e05033e207473504dc4df999ce49385fb1f8b058a /sqlalchemy-2.0.36 .tar.gz"
88- sha256 "7f2767680b6d2398aea7082e45a774b2b0767b5c8d8ffb9c8b683088ea9b29c5 "
91+ url "https://files.pythonhosted.org/packages/68/c3/3f2bfa5e4dcd9938405fe2fab5b6ab94a9248a4f9536ea2fd497da20525f /sqlalchemy-2.0.40 .tar.gz"
92+ sha256 "d827099289c64589418ebbcaead0145cd19f4e3e8a93919a0100247af245fa00 "
8993 end
9094
9195 resource "textual" do
92- url "https://files.pythonhosted.org/packages/61/6a/e643a0d32dc964f831172ff84d4d1b0e3c6675954e74f81c201713c58d69 /textual-0.87.1 .tar.gz"
93- sha256 "daf4e248ba3d890831ff2617099535eb835863a2e3609c8ce00af0f6d55ed123 "
96+ url "https://files.pythonhosted.org/packages/34/99/8408761a1a1076b2bb69d4859ec110d74be7515552407ac1cb6b68630eb6 /textual-3.2.0 .tar.gz"
97+ sha256 "d2f3b0c39e02535bb5f2aec1c45e10bd3ee7508ed1e240b7505c3cf02a6f00ed "
9498 end
9599
96100 resource "typing-extensions" do
97- url "https://files.pythonhosted.org/packages/df/db/f35a00659bc03fec321ba8bce9420de607a1d37f8342eee1863174c69557 /typing_extensions-4.12 .2.tar.gz"
98- sha256 "1a7ead55c7e559dd4dee8856e3a88b41225abfe1ce8df57b7c13915fe121ffb8 "
101+ url "https://files.pythonhosted.org/packages/f6/37/23083fcd6e35492953e8d2aaaa68b860eb422b34627b13f2ce3eb6106061 /typing_extensions-4.13 .2.tar.gz"
102+ sha256 "e6c81219bd689f51865d9e372991c540bda33a0379d5573cddb9a3a23f7caaef "
99103 end
100104
101105 resource "tzlocal" do
102- url "https://files.pythonhosted.org/packages/04/d3/c19d65ae67636fe63953b20c2e4a8ced4497ea232c43ff8d01db16de8dc0 /tzlocal-5.2 .tar.gz"
103- sha256 "8d399205578f1a9342816409cc1e46a93ebd5755e39ea2d85334bea911bf0e6e "
106+ url "https://files.pythonhosted.org/packages/8b/2e/c14812d3d4d9cd1773c6be938f89e5735a1f11a9f184ac3639b93cef35d5 /tzlocal-5.3.1 .tar.gz"
107+ sha256 "cceffc7edecefea1f595541dbd6e990cb1ea3d19bf01b2809f362a03dd7921fd "
104108 end
105109
106110 resource "uc-micro-py" do
@@ -109,6 +113,9 @@ class Dooit < Formula
109113 end
110114
111115 def install
116+ # The source doesn't have a valid SOURCE_DATE_EPOCH, so here we set default.
117+ ENV [ "SOURCE_DATE_EPOCH" ] = "1451574000"
118+
112119 virtualenv_install_with_resources
113120
114121 generate_completions_from_executable ( bin /"dooit" , shells : [ :fish , :zsh ] , shell_parameter_format : :click )
0 commit comments